Obituary for Jacqueline Sarah Jennings (Lake)

Jacqueline Sarah  Jennings (Lake)
Jennings, Jacqueline Sarah (Lake), passed away Wed., Sept. 14, 2016 in Aiken, SC.

Jacqueline Sarah (Lake) Jennings was born December 9, 1923 to Harry Eber Lake and Lottie Bell Lake in St. Louis, Missouri. She lived all her life in St. Louis, until 2010 when she became a resident of Harbor Chase Assisted Living in Aiken, SC, during which time Melany Jean Heard, her daughter, served as her primary caretaker.

Jacqueline was a charter member of the Webster Hills Methodist Church where she attended for over 50 years. Most of her many activities included those centered around church. She also enjoyed being a member of the Webster Hills Women's Group, and the Glendale Women's Club.

Jacqueline's love of animals lead to her being a life long supporter of the Humane Society and an avid fan of any animal, especially her own dogs. Jacqueline also really enjoyed fishing, boating, swimming, camping, traveling and exercise.

Jacqueline was a wife for 30 years to Robert Samuel Jennings and they had many happy times traveling all over the United States camping, fishing, and seeing the sights. After Robert's passing, she continued her travels to include many foreign countries.

Jacqueline leaves behind a sister, Josephine Engle (Robert) of Grover, MO; a daughter, Jacqueline Boyer (Larry) of Altoona, IA; a daughter, Melany Jean Heard (Steve) of Aiken, SC; and a son, Robert (Sue) Jennings of Woodland Park, CO; a step-daughter, Sandra (Rob) Roth of Hernando FL; a granddaughter, Michele (Bill) Blood of Flemington, NJ;a granddaughter, Vicki Jennings Maniatis of South Orange, NJ; and a granddaughter, Kimberly (Brian) Laube of Altoona, IA. Also left behind are her 5 great grandchildren, Kelsey (Ryan) Sage, Laura Laube, Olivia Laube, Alexander Laube, and Alexander Maniatis. Great great grandchildren include Trevor and Austin Sage of Indian Trail, NC. Also, she leaves a nephew, Jerry Tobey, two nieces, Deanna Hanks and Terry Bauman, and 3 step grandchildren.

Proceeding her in death were her mother and father Harry and Lottie Lake of St. Louis, MO and her husband of 30 years, Robert Samuel Jennings of St. Louis in 1977.

Funeral from Bopp Chapel, 10610 Manchester Rd., Kirkwood, MO 63122, on Tuesday, September 20, at 11:15 am for 12:00 pm Committal Service in the Chapel at St. Matthew's Cemetery in St. Louis.
